Rapid urban expansion has created new challenges for planners seeking durable and adaptable paving solutions. Traditional concrete and asphalt surfaces often struggle with cracking, water retention, and costly repairs. In contrast, interlocking concrete pavers offer a modular approach that aligns with modern infrastructure requirements. Their ability to support heavy loads while maintaining surface integrity has made them a reliable choice across commercial and public spaces.

The Interlocking Concrete Paver Market is increasingly influenced by large-scale infrastructure projects, including highways, airports, and logistics hubs. These applications demand materials that can withstand frequent use without significant degradation. Interlocking pavers meet these expectations by allowing localized repairs instead of full surface replacement, significantly reducing long-term maintenance costs for asset owners.

Sustainability considerations further reinforce market growth. Interlocking concrete pavers support permeable designs that enhance groundwater recharge and mitigate heat island effects in dense urban areas. These environmental advantages align with stricter construction regulations and sustainability benchmarks being adopted worldwide. As climate resilience becomes a central focus of urban design, demand for adaptable paving systems is expected to intensify.
